Skip to content

fix: imports with only types are removed even if verbatimModuleSyntax is true#3784

Merged
IWANABETHATGUY merged 2 commits intomainfrom
03-08-fix_imports_with_only_types_are_removed_even_if_verbatimmodulesyntax_is_true
Mar 8, 2025
Merged

fix: imports with only types are removed even if verbatimModuleSyntax is true#3784
IWANABETHATGUY merged 2 commits intomainfrom
03-08-fix_imports_with_only_types_are_removed_even_if_verbatimmodulesyntax_is_true

Conversation

@IWANABETHATGUY
Copy link
Member

@IWANABETHATGUY IWANABETHATGUY commented Mar 8, 2025

Copy link
Member Author

IWANABETHATGUY commented Mar 8, 2025

@IWANABETHATGUY IWANABETHATGUY marked this pull request as ready for review March 8, 2025 04:22
@IWANABETHATGUY IWANABETHATGUY force-pushed the 03-08-fix_imports_with_only_types_are_removed_even_if_verbatimmodulesyntax_is_true branch from d9db755 to c0d0809 Compare March 8, 2025 04:25
@github-actions
Copy link
Contributor

github-actions bot commented Mar 8, 2025

Benchmarks Rust

  • target: 03-08-chore_bump_oxc_resolver(c7a16d2)
  • pr: 03-08-fix_imports_with_only_types_are_removed_even_if_verbatimmodulesyntax_is_true(c0d0809)
group                                                               pr                                     target
-----                                                               --                                     ------
bundle/bundle@multi-duplicated-top-level-symbol                     1.00     74.5±0.76ms        ? ?/sec    1.03     76.5±2.09ms        ? ?/sec
bundle/bundle@multi-duplicated-top-level-symbol-minify              1.00     95.9±1.25ms        ? ?/sec    1.01     96.4±1.89ms        ? ?/sec
bundle/bundle@multi-duplicated-top-level-symbol-minify-sourcemap    1.00    108.6±1.00ms        ? ?/sec    1.01    109.3±1.80ms        ? ?/sec
bundle/bundle@multi-duplicated-top-level-symbol-sourcemap           1.00     83.2±1.16ms        ? ?/sec    1.01     83.9±1.16ms        ? ?/sec
bundle/bundle@rome-ts                                               1.00    125.4±1.32ms        ? ?/sec    1.01    126.4±2.37ms        ? ?/sec
bundle/bundle@rome-ts-minify                                        1.01    209.4±3.71ms        ? ?/sec    1.00    208.3±3.38ms        ? ?/sec
bundle/bundle@rome-ts-minify-sourcemap                              1.00    243.6±5.99ms        ? ?/sec    1.00    242.9±4.54ms        ? ?/sec
bundle/bundle@rome-ts-sourcemap                                     1.00    138.3±2.10ms        ? ?/sec    1.00    138.1±1.57ms        ? ?/sec
bundle/bundle@threejs                                               1.00     42.0±1.36ms        ? ?/sec    1.04     43.8±2.40ms        ? ?/sec
bundle/bundle@threejs-minify                                        1.02     89.3±3.13ms        ? ?/sec    1.00     87.4±0.57ms        ? ?/sec
bundle/bundle@threejs-minify-sourcemap                              1.00    102.3±1.30ms        ? ?/sec    1.00    102.6±0.90ms        ? ?/sec
bundle/bundle@threejs-sourcemap                                     1.00     48.4±0.55ms        ? ?/sec    1.01     48.8±0.33ms        ? ?/sec
bundle/bundle@threejs10x                                            1.00    438.4±4.38ms        ? ?/sec    1.01    444.5±4.19ms        ? ?/sec
bundle/bundle@threejs10x-minify                                     1.00   1097.5±6.71ms        ? ?/sec    1.01  1109.6±10.44ms        ? ?/sec
bundle/bundle@threejs10x-minify-sourcemap                           1.00  1300.2±15.39ms        ? ?/sec    1.00   1295.3±8.28ms        ? ?/sec
bundle/bundle@threejs10x-sourcemap                                  1.00    508.7±3.93ms        ? ?/sec    1.01    515.0±4.39ms        ? ?/sec
remapping/remapping                                                 1.01     27.7±0.71ms        ? ?/sec    1.00     27.3±0.31ms        ? ?/sec
remapping/render-chunk-remapping                                    1.00     68.4±5.32ms        ? ?/sec    1.02     69.7±6.12ms        ? ?/sec
scan/scan@rome-ts                                                   1.01     97.3±1.53ms        ? ?/sec    1.00     96.8±2.05ms        ? ?/sec
scan/scan@threejs                                                   1.00     32.2±1.00ms        ? ?/sec    1.00     32.1±1.26ms        ? ?/sec
scan/scan@threejs10x                                                1.00    324.8±4.57ms        ? ?/sec    1.00    323.5±3.58ms        ? ?/sec

Base automatically changed from 03-08-chore_bump_oxc_resolver to main March 8, 2025 04:45
@IWANABETHATGUY IWANABETHATGUY added this pull request to the merge queue Mar 8, 2025
Merged via the queue into main with commit ff8d19d Mar 8, 2025
22 checks passed
@IWANABETHATGUY IWANABETHATGUY deleted the 03-08-fix_imports_with_only_types_are_removed_even_if_verbatimmodulesyntax_is_true branch March 8, 2025 05:01
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

[Bug]: imports with only types are removed even if verbatimModuleSyntax is true

2 participants